ubuntu18.04安装freeswitch
时间: 2023-10-15 08:31:36 浏览: 134
首先,确保您已经安装了Ubuntu 18.04操作系统。然后按照以下步骤安装FreeSWITCH:
打开终端,并使用以下命令更新软件包列表:
sudo apt update
安装依赖项,使用以下命令:
sudo apt install -y autoconf automake libtool libjpeg-dev libncurses5-dev libsqlite3-dev libssl-dev libcurl4-openssl-dev libpcre3-dev libspeex-dev libspeexdsp-dev libldns-dev libedit-dev yasm libopus-dev
下载FreeSWITCH源代码,使用以下命令:
cd ~ wget https://github.com/signalwire/freeswitch/archive/v1.10.5.tar.gz
解压下载的文件,使用以下命令:
tar -zxvf v1.10.5.tar.gz
进入解压后的目录,使用以下命令:
cd freeswitch-1.10.5
配置并编译FreeSWITCH,使用以下命令:
./bootstrap.sh -j ./configure make
安装FreeSWITCH,使用以下命令:
sudo make install sudo make hd-sounds-install sudo make hd-moh-install
配置FreeSWITCH服务,使用以下命令:
sudo cp /usr/local/freeswitch/bin/freeswitch.init.debian /etc/init.d/freeswitch sudo chmod +x /etc/init.d/freeswitch sudo update-rc.d -f freeswitch defaults
启动FreeSWITCH服务,使用以下命令:
sudo service freeswitch start
现在,FreeSWITCH已成功安装在您的Ubuntu 18.04上。您可以使用相关文档或配置文件进行进一步的配置和使用。
相关推荐















